Read MoreNASA Reports Arctic Stratospheric Ozone Depletion Hit Record Low in March.
Ozone levels above the Arctic reached a record low for March, NASA researchers report. An analysis of satellite observations show that ozone levels reached their lowest point on March 12 at 205 Dobson units.
